Membership Manager
The International News Media Association (INMA) is a global non-profit organization dedicated to reinventing how news publishers engage audiences and grow revenue in an increasingly digital world. INMA aims to make journalism financially sustainable. While the bulk of the INMA team is based in Dallas, operations are 100% work-from-home virtual.  The Membership Manager is responsible for overseeing all aspects of the organization's individual and corporate membership strategies, attracting new members, retaining existing memberships, managing member data, developing engagement initiatives, and analyzing membership trends to ensure the association maintains a healthy and active member base.
